What affects the price

Roof repair costs depend on several specific factors. The size of the damaged area is the biggest variable, along with the accessibility of your roof and the pitch or steepness involved. We also look at the underlying materials—like whether you have standard asphalt shingles, metal, or tile—and the complexity of the flashing around chimneys or vents. If the wood decking underneath is rotted or damaged, that adds to the labor and material needs. We provide ex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

Commercial roofing services involve the repair or replacement of flat or low-slope roofs typically found on office buildings, warehouses, and retail spaces. These systems require specialized membranes or coating materials to prevent pooling water. You need these experts if you are experiencing leaks in a commercial facility or need a scheduled maintenance plan to protect your business assets. Costs are driven by roof size and material type. How do metal roof colors affect the temperature of a home in Colorado Springs?

Lighter metal roof colors can reflect more sunlight, helping to keep a home cooler in the summer heat of Colorado Springs. Darker colors absorb more heat. Choosing the right color can contribute to energy efficiency. This is especially beneficial during warmer months. Consider this factor for your home's comfort and energy bills.
